Cycle at a relaxed pace with your small group for four hours along the 'back road' - Ara Metua, lane ways and occasional gentle terrain bush tracks. You will experience the tranquil pace of local village life, and enjoy the beautiful scenery. There are plenty of stops along the way where your tour guide will tell you more about what you are seeing and experiencing. The 'explore' tour concludes with a picnic lunch at the beach, where you can have a swim to cool off. This is the more advanced of our three bicycle tours

Arorangi
Explore Arorangi village on the west coast of Rarotonga. Tour may include seeing the local prison, CICC Arorangi church, palace, Black Rock, and local gardens.
